This paper proposes a simple packet rate estimator that can be very useful in predicting the rate of network traffic. The quality and performance of the estimator is evaluated and compared with three popular rate estimators that were originally designed for estimating bit rate. The proposed estimator is highly cost effective as its computation is not carried out upon the arrival of each incoming packet. In addition, the computation is simple and does not depend on the measurement of interarrival times of packets. We evaluate and compare the quality and performance in terms of agility, stability, accuracy and cost. The performance evaluation is conducted using discrete-event simulation that produces synthesized bursty traffic with empirical packet sizes.
